Early Life
Growing up in the picturesque surroundings of Southern California, Jared Breeze was born on January 10, 2005, to a supportive and loving family. From a young age, Jared showed a natural talent for performance and entertainment, captivating those around him with his charisma and presence.
First Steps in Acting
Jared's journey into the world of acting began in 2013 when he landed his first professional role in the children's film WonderGrove Kids: Game of Wonders. This marked the beginning of his acting career, and he quickly went on to earn two more credits that same year, showcasing his dedication and passion for his craft.

Rising to Prominence
In 2015, Jared made two appearances in the TV comedy Your Family or Mine as the lovable character Dougie, showcasing his versatility as an actor. He then took on the challenging role of Max Rayburn in the soap opera The Young and the Restless in January 2016, solidifying his presence in the entertainment industry.
